Output 58dbd6a4df761a39789cce3ba7dc179e5347e696b77b721e2c5ae77a349657ae:6

value
989970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30117981366315073bd3ba366b95cb58adc2e2d5 OP_EQUAL
address
MCHKbo9cBgHwx9akztgSZUK1CM4yaQmRyK
transaction
58dbd6a4df761a39789cce3ba7dc179e5347e696b77b721e2c5ae77a349657ae
spent
true